July 24 1998
Update : new version SGV 2.10
Functional Changes:
The geometry description now allows for a short-hand way of
defining repeating layers. See the User's Guide.
The geometry initialization now makes more checks, and tries
to report the sources of problems.
The geometry initialization now sorts cylinders (planes) in R
(Z), before loading into the internal geometry data-base.
Hence, the input-file no longer needs to be sorted.
A steering card PRDET has been defined. If true, a printing of the
detector geometries as loaded internally in SGV is produced.
The possibility to have several detector geometries loaded in
a single run has been revised, and should now work correctly.
There is now a possibility to set the random-number generator
seeds. On VMS, there is an option to generate the seeds automatically
from the wall-clock. A UNIX version of this feature is foreseen for
the next minor update. For details, see the User's Guide.
Bug fixes :
A variable declaration in the External Read version of ZEUGEN
was missing. This has been fixed.
The random switching between processes, when several were generated at
in the same run in SUSYGEN was not correct.
This has been fixed.
Note, however, that this will only work if the processes are
selected with the SUSYGEN card PROCSEL, not if the logical
cards ZINO, WINO, SELECTRON etc. are used.
In the course of the revision of the multiple-geometry option,
it was discovered that the geometry access routines were not
correct if more than one detector was loaded at the same time.
This has been fixed, but the calling sequence of these routines
had to be changed. The routines concerned are:
The difference is that the geometry-number (IGEO or IGEOM)
should be REMOVED from the argument list.

Interface considerations :
Please look at the SUSYGEN version of ZEUGEN in sgvuser.car.
It contains instruction on how to use the latest SUSYGEN
(version 2.20/03), which has changed the calling sequence
to SUSEVE wrt. previous versions.
